    Overview of Smooth Jazz musician Chris Botti

    Chris Botti is a well-known jazz musician from Corvallis, Oregon, who is famous for his trumpet prowess. His musical taste is influenced by easy jazz, a jazz subgenre known for its gentle and soothing tones. Botti's work combines several musical genres, such as jazz, pop, and classical music, to create a distinctive sound.

    Botti's trumpet playing is slick and soulful, and his music is passionate and emotional. His music has a way of luring listeners into an alternate reality where they can unwind and unwind. He has a talent for distilling the essence of human emotions into musical notes.

    Botti is known as one of the best jazz trumpeters of his time thanks to his abilities. He has collaborated with some of the biggest names in music, such as Yo-Yo Ma, Andrea Bocelli, and Sting. Botti has received praise from the music community and numerous honors, including a Grammy for Best Pop Instrumental Album.

    What are the latest songs and music albums for Smooth Jazz musician Chris Botti?

    American jazz and smooth jazz musician Chris Botti hails from Corvallis. Impressions, his most recent CD, was published in 2012 and features trumpet virtuosity. Collaborations with musicians such Andrea Bocelli, Vince Gill, and David Foster are among those on the CD. Impressions features a mix of original songs and covers, all of which highlight Botti's distinctive talent and approach.

    "For All We Know," Chris Botti's most recent single, was released in 2013. The jazz standard is beautifully performed on this song, which also contains Botti's distinctive trumpet tone. The song shows evidence of Botti's talent for interpreting and incorporating his flair into classic songs.

    The 2009 CD Chris Botti In Boston, which was his first, includes live performances with the Boston Pops Orchestra and notable guests like Yo-Yo Ma, John Mayer, and Sting. 2010 saw the record win a Grammy for "Best Pop Instrumental Album." Another noteworthy album by Botti is Italia, which was published in 2007 and includes his renditions of well-known Italian classics including "Con te partiro" and "Estate."

    Where did Chris Botti get his start?

    Chris Botti left for the University of Indiana after finishing high school before relocating to New York. His biggest opportunity came when Sting offered him a seat in his band, however he began his career by performing with musicians like Paul Simon and Joni Mitchell.

    What trumpet does Chris Botti use?

    Botti plays on his one-and-only 1939 Martin trumpet.


    Did Chris Botti play with Sting?

    Sting and Botti worked together on multiple albums, including All This Time, When I Fall in Love, To Love Again, and Chris Botti in Boston, after Botti went on tour with Sting in the late 1990s.

    Does Chris Botti write his own music?

    Chris Botti, a trumpet player, has a fruitful recording career and had four solo albums out by 2001. Additionally, he writes and produces the music for motion pictures, such as Caught and Playing by Heart.
